What?

Streaming major Roku (NASDAQ:ROKU) is looking to double down on content, with plans to develop over 50 original shows over the next two years.

The move could help the company bolster advertising revenues via its Roku Channel, which lets users watch free ad-supported content. Roku sells 100% of the ads when viewers watch the Roku Channel, compared to under 30% of the ads when viewers watch content in other apps on the Roku platform.
